Rejected petition Discuss the concerning rise of HMOs in Gainsborough and Lincolnshire area.
The rise of HMOs in Gainsborough and Lincolnshire is increasing risks to community safety, security, and quality of housing. We urge stronger planning controls, strict licensing, and better council support to protect residents and preserve neighborhood stability.
More details
The Government can help by requiring full planning permission for all HMOs, enforcing strict safety and licensing standards, limiting HMO density in neighborhoods, funding councils to monitor properties, consulting communities on new HMOs, and researching the social impact to guide policy—ensuring safe, affordable housing without harming families or local infrastructure.
